suite retire и проверка словаря в документе для читателя
- suite retire снимает правило, конвенцию или тему: правило остаётся заглушкой с датой и причиной, имя уезжает в раздел выбывших, снятие с непогашенными ссылками отклоняется с перечнем мест - добавлена проверка META-30: короткое описание языка обязано называть все слова словаря, иначе читатель копии толкует их по памяти - retired-раздел манифеста больше не считается объявлением пути: снятый префикс означает, что файл ушёл вместе с ним
